Output 03cfaf2907007e215aac9e311192ab76f748821ba95fa95c5cd2a17d4d4f7715:1

value
24629
script pubkey
OP_0 OP_PUSHBYTES_20 712f39c294d454db3fad151059ed3f2166b18322
address
tb1qwyhnns55632dk0adz5g9nmfly9ntrqez0z8cnv
transaction
03cfaf2907007e215aac9e311192ab76f748821ba95fa95c5cd2a17d4d4f7715
confirmations
61054
spent
true